Household and climate factors influence <i>Aedes aegypti</i> risk in the arid city of Huaquillas, Ecuador
2020-05-22
Abstract excerpt
Arboviruses transmitted by Aedes aegypti (e.g., dengue, chikungunya, Zika) are of major public health concern on the arid coastal border of Ecuador and Peru. This high transit border is a critical disease surveillance site due to human movement-associated risk of transmission.
